‘Project X’ Tops The List Of Most Pirated Movies Of 2012

According to a list of most pirated movies of 2012, Project X is the most pirated movie of the year, followed closely by 'Mission Impossible: The Ghost Protocol.'

Every year, the most pirated movies are usually the very same which enjoy mainstream popularity. However, according to a list of most pirated movies of 2012 compiled by TorrentFreak, Project X has lead the race this year, despite being a rather unpopular flick in the face of numerous other blockbusters.


Top pirated movies 2012

Project X was probably the only surprise in this list. It was downloaded 8,720,000 times, and was followed closely by ‘Mission Impossible – Ghost Protocol’ which was able to amass 8,500,000 downloads.

‘The Dark Knight Rises’ fell to the third place while ‘The Avengers’ reached the fourth position. Other movies on the list of top ten most pirated movies include ‘Sherlock Holmes: A Game of Shadows’ and ‘The Twilight Saga: Breaking Dawn – Part 1.’

The fact that Project X was able to top this list does show that the popularity of a given movie title within the domain of piracy may not be synonymous to its success on the box office. Nonetheless, if a movie is a fair box office hit, there’s a huge chance that it will end up being pirated far and wide on the web. Again, that can’t always be the case – we saw what a smash ‘Hunger Games’ was in terms of its gross revenue but the film never showed up on this list.

The downloads statistics compiled by TorrentFreak come from public BitTorrents trackers alone, meaning that they may not represent the complete download counts of the individual titles. Still, this is a close estimate and thus, reliable.
